Exploring the Future of the Global Wheelchair Market Growth

Understanding the Wheelchair Market Dynamics
The global wheelchair market exhibits promising growth prospects, aiming to reach USD 9.68 billion by 2032 according to recent projections. As of 2023, the market stood at USD 5.18 billion, showing a robust comp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of 7.21% over the coming years. The increase is attributed to a combination of factors, primarily driven by the aging population and the surging demand for assistive mobility aids.

Regional Market Insights
The North American wheelchair market dominates, attributed to high healthcare expenditures and supportive infrastructure. The region is forecasted to grow to USD 2.65 billion by 2032, driven by a greater awareness of the accessibility of mobility aids. In contrast, the Asia-Pacific region is anticipated to experience the highest growth due to rapidly aging populations and increased government spending on healthcare and rehabilitation programs.

The Impact of Rehabilitation Centers on the Market
Rehabilitation centers play a crucial role in boosting wheelchair demand. With a market share of 38.4%, these centers require wheelchairs for both short and long-term patient care. The rise in rehabilitation facilities and outpatient services further drives the need for effective mobility solutions. Hospitals, too, are likely to require more wheelchairs due to their growing infrastructure and the need for mobility devices in various departments.
